Aachen Smell that cinnamon... and is that coriander? The exact ingredients are a well-kept secret of each local bakery that produces it, but Aacheners have been making Aachener Printen – their own engraved take on traditional lebkuchen – for 600 years! Its seductive scent… mingled with glühwein and other holiday treats… welcomes you to this ancient German city’s Weihnachtsmarkt. Aachen’s Gothic cathedral overlooks a brightly lit holiday wonderland of festive greenery, gingerbread houses and handmade crafts; steam rises from food stalls, releasing the most delicious aromas. Be sure to sample local favorites like potato fritters, spekulatius biscuits, marzipan, and of course printen; although the city’s bakeries ship these goodies all over the world, there’s nothing like enjoying them here… fresh and hot!
